.page-module__-rzagW__patternNav{background:var(--card);border-radius:var(--radius);border:1px solid var(--border);justify-content:space-between;align-items:center;padding:1rem;display:flex}.page-module__-rzagW__navBrand{color:var(--primary);font-size:1.25rem;font-weight:700}.page-module__-rzagW__navMenu{gap:2rem;margin:0;padding:0;list-style:none;display:flex}.page-module__-rzagW__navMenu a{color:var(--foreground);font-size:.875rem;text-decoration:none;transition:color .2s}.page-module__-rzagW__navMenu a:hover{color:var(--primary)}.page-module__-rzagW__navCta{background:var(--primary);color:var(--primary-foreground);border-radius:calc(var(--radius) - 2px);cursor:pointer;border:none;padding:.5rem 1.5rem;font-size:.875rem;font-weight:600;transition:opacity .2s}.page-module__-rzagW__navCta:hover{opacity:.9}.page-module__-rzagW__patternCards{gap:1rem;display:flex}.page-module__-rzagW__patternCard{background:var(--card);border-radius:var(--radius);border:1px solid var(--border);flex-direction:column;flex:1;padding:1.5rem;display:flex}.page-module__-rzagW__patternCard h4{color:var(--primary);margin:0 0 .5rem;font-size:.9375rem;font-weight:600}.page-module__-rzagW__patternCard p{color:var(--muted-foreground);flex:1;margin:0 0 1rem;font-size:.8125rem;line-height:1.5}.page-module__-rzagW__patternCard button{background:var(--primary);color:var(--primary-foreground);border-radius:calc(var(--radius) - 2px);cursor:pointer;border:none;padding:.5rem 1rem;font-size:.8125rem;font-weight:600;transition:opacity .2s}.page-module__-rzagW__patternCard button:hover{opacity:.9}.page-module__-rzagW__patternMedia{background:var(--card);border-radius:var(--radius);border:1px solid var(--border);align-items:flex-start;gap:1rem;padding:1rem;display:flex}.page-module__-rzagW__mediaImage{background:var(--primary);border-radius:var(--radius);flex:0 0 100px;height:100px}.page-module__-rzagW__mediaContent{flex:1}.page-module__-rzagW__mediaContent h4{color:var(--primary);margin:0 0 .5rem;font-size:.9375rem;font-weight:600}.page-module__-rzagW__mediaContent p{color:var(--muted-foreground);margin:0;font-size:.8125rem;line-height:1.5}.page-module__-rzagW__patternSticky{background:var(--card);border-radius:var(--radius);border:1px solid var(--border);flex-direction:column;height:300px;display:flex;overflow:hidden}.page-module__-rzagW__stickyHeader,.page-module__-rzagW__stickyFooter{background:var(--primary);color:var(--primary-foreground);text-align:center;padding:1rem;font-size:.875rem;font-weight:600}.page-module__-rzagW__stickyContent{background:var(--muted);color:var(--muted-foreground);flex:1;justify-content:center;align-items:center;padding:1rem;font-size:.875rem;display:flex}.page-module__-rzagW__inputGroups{flex-direction:column;gap:1rem;display:flex}.page-module__-rzagW__patternInputGroup{border-radius:calc(var(--radius) - 2px);border:1px solid var(--border);display:flex;overflow:hidden}.page-module__-rzagW__patternInputGroup input{background:var(--card);color:var(--foreground);border:none;outline:none;flex:1;padding:.75rem;font-family:inherit;font-size:.875rem}.page-module__-rzagW__patternInputGroup input::placeholder{color:var(--muted-foreground)}.page-module__-rzagW__inputAddon{background:var(--muted);color:var(--muted-foreground);border-right:1px solid var(--border);align-items:center;padding:0 1rem;font-size:.875rem;font-weight:600;display:flex}.page-module__-rzagW__inputButton{background:var(--primary);color:var(--primary-foreground);cursor:pointer;border:none;padding:0 1.5rem;font-size:.875rem;font-weight:600;transition:opacity .2s}.page-module__-rzagW__inputButton:hover{opacity:.9}.page-module__-rzagW__patternHolyGrail{gap:1rem;min-height:200px;display:flex}.page-module__-rzagW__sidebarLeft,.page-module__-rzagW__sidebarRight{background:var(--primary);color:var(--primary-foreground);border-radius:calc(var(--radius) - 2px);text-align:center;flex:0 0 80px;justify-content:center;align-items:center;padding:1rem;font-size:.875rem;font-weight:600;display:flex}.page-module__-rzagW__sidebarRight{background:var(--secondary);color:var(--secondary-foreground)}.page-module__-rzagW__mainContent{background:var(--card);border-radius:calc(var(--radius) - 2px);border:1px solid var(--border);color:var(--muted-foreground);flex:1;justify-content:center;align-items:center;padding:1rem;font-size:.875rem;display:flex}.page-module__-rzagW__tipsGrid{gr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:1.5rem;display:grid}.page-module__-rzagW__tipCard{background:var(--card);border:1px solid var(--border);border-radius:var(--radius);padding:1.5rem;transition:border-color .2s,box-shadow .2s;position:relative}.page-module__-rzagW__tipCard:hover{border-color:var(--primary);box-shadow:0 4px 20px #0000000f;box-shadow:0 4px 20px lab(0% 0 0/.06)}.page-module__-rzagW__tipIcon{background:var(--primary);width:2.5rem;height:2.5rem;color:var(--primary-foreground);border-radius:calc(var(--radius) - 2px);font-family:var(--font-jetbrains-mono),monospace;justify-content:center;align-items:center;margin-bottom:1rem;font-size:1rem;font-weight:700;display:inline-flex}.page-module__-rzagW__tipCard h3{color:var(--foreground);margin-bottom:.5rem;font-size:1rem;font-weight:600}.page-module__-rzagW__tipCard p{color:var(--muted-foreground);margin:0;font-size:.8125rem;line-height:1.6}.page-module__-rzagW__nextGrid{gr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:1.5rem;max-width:900px;display:grid}.page-module__-rzagW__nextLink{background:var(--card);border:1px solid var(--border);border-radius:var(--radius);color:inherit;align-items:center;gap:1rem;padding:1.5rem;text-decoration:none;transition:border-color .3s,transform .3s cubic-bezier(.34,1.56,.64,1),box-shadow .3s;display:flex;position:relative;overflow:hidden}.page-module__-rzagW__nextLink:before{content:"";background:linear-gradient(to bottom,var(--primary),#4ea4ca);opacity:0;width:3px;transition:opacity .3s;position:absolute;top:0;bottom:0;left:0}@supports (color:lab(0% 0 0)){.page-module__-rzagW__nextLink:before{background:linear-gradient(to bottom,var(--primary),lab(63.1292% -18.1274 -28.0657))}}.page-module__-rzagW__nextLink:hover{border-color:var(--primary);transform:translateY(-3px);box-shadow:0 12px 28px #357a3a1f,0 4px 10px #0000000f;box-shadow:0 12px 28px lab(45.7706% -33.6758 28.0119/.12),0 4px 10px lab(0% 0 0/.06)}.page-module__-rzagW__nextLink:hover:before{opacity:1}.page-module__-rzagW__nextIcon{font-size:2rem;font-family:var(--font-jetbrains-mono),monospace;color:var(--primary);flex-shrink:0}.page-module__-rzagW__nextLink h3{color:var(--foreground);margin-bottom:.25rem;font-size:1.125rem;font-weight:600}.page-module__-rzagW__nextLink p{color:var(--muted-foreground);margin:0;font-size:.8125rem}@media (max-width:768px){.page-module__-rzagW__patternCards{flex-direction:column}.page-module__-rzagW__patternNav{flex-wrap:wrap;gap:1rem}.page-module__-rzagW__navMenu{justify-content:center;width:100%}.page-module__-rzagW__patternHolyGrail{flex-direction:column}.page-module__-rzagW__sidebarLeft,.page-module__-rzagW__sidebarRight{flex:none}.page-module__-rzagW__tipsGrid,.page-module__-rzagW__nextGrid{grid-template-columns:1fr}}@media (max-width:480px){.page-module__-rzagW__navMenu{text-align:center;flex-direction:column;gap:.5rem}}
